Aside from stoppages sewer lines also develop additional issues over time, predominantly cracks and leaks. The leaks let wastewater get into walls, floors and eventually to the foundations of the property or house which can compromise the structural integrity of the property.
Apart from that, sewage leaks can mix with ground water and result in contamination. So, for your own property and health's sake, get your pipes examined and repaired by Troy Drain & Sewer Services. If you notice signs of failing The reason for this can be traced to a list of causes. In general, the majority of sewer problems are attributed to any combination of the following reasons:
- Intruding tree roots: Trees on your property could pose a threat to your sewer line , as their roots grow and invade your pipes. If tree roots enter the sewer line, they can block it entirely or cause leaks, eventually leading to failure.
- Blockages Obstructions may form within your sewer line due to almost anything you flush down your drains, including food waste and paper products not designed to be flushed grease that has been coagulated, and other objects.
- Age: Nothing lasts forever even your sewer line. Your sewer lining can be damaged or cracked over the course of time, creating an unpleasant mess. It is crucial to arrange regular sewer inspections by qualified professionals in order to prevent this.

- Broken, cracked, or offset pipes. Certain factors, such as changing soils, freezing ground, and settling, may cause pipes to shift from their original location and in turn cause the pipes to suffer damage.
- Corrosionpipes that have been damaged not only affect the water quality entering your home, but they can may also cause damage to pipes.
- Blockage is the case when a foreign material or grease build-up hinders or blocks the flow of water out of your drains to the sewer line.
- Bellied pipe - It occurs when ground or soil conditions destroy a part of the pipe. A bellied pipe may develop into a valley and be able to store water that was not used.
- Leaky joints If the seals that connected the pipe joints erode, it would provide the space for water to seep out.
- Tree roots in the sewer line - The roots of trees and bushes in your front yard can wrap around the sewer lines and, after some time, they may actually crack the pipes.
- Off-grade pipe - This issue is a result of using low-quality pipes. The pipes are vulnerable to deterioration and corrosion.
If the sewer line is damaged, do you need to repair it? or replacement? If small cracks or holes appear within the sewer line generally, a repair is needed. If the pipe is corroding to a greater extent or damage that is more extensive replacement of the sewer line may be needed. How can we tell what is required even though all of the pipes are underground? To determine whether there is damage to your pipes and the extent of the damage, we perform the test of a leak in your pipe. If we discover damage or leak, we can do trenchless repairs in certain cases, but replacements do require us to dig the sewer line up.
